详细内容

gromacs教程-22-常见建模软件-gmx genconf

gmx genconf [-f [<.gro/.g96/...>]] [-o [<.gro/.g96/...>]]

[-trj [<.xtc/.trr/...>]] [-nice ] [-nbox ]

[-dist ] [-seed ] [-[no]rot] [-[no]shuffle]

[-[no]sort] [-block ] [-nmolat ] [-maxrot ]

[-[no]renumber]


对给定的坐标文件进行简单的堆叠, 就像小孩子玩积木一样


gmx genconf -f 1.gro -o 2.gro -nbox 4 2 3

-nbox表示每个方向复制多少个box

如果输入结构没有box的时候就会出现报错的行为,导致原子键断裂 

image.png

image.png


gmx editconf -f 1.gro -o box.gro -box 1.5 0.5 0.5

gmx genconf -f box.gro -o 3.gro -nbox 4 2 3 

image.png

image.png


gmx genconf -f box.gro -o 4.gro -nbox 4 2 3  -dist  6 10 20

-dist设置盒子之间的距离,分别为xyz方向 

image.png


gmx genconf -f box.gro -o 5.gro -nbox 4 2 3  -rot

-rot增加原子随机旋转构象

image.png

image.png

image.png


gmx genconf -f box.gro -o 6.gro -nbox 4 2 3  -maxrot  90 0 180

-maxrot  90 0 180 最大的随机转动90° 0° 180° 如果没有rot这个maxrot就没有用

gmx genconf -f box.gro -o 7.gro -nbox 4 2 3  -maxrot  90 0 180 -rot


-renumber重新编号残基

-seed 随机数发生器的种子, 如果为0, 根据当前时间产生

image.png

image.png


gmx genconf -trj md.xtc -o 8.gro -nbox 3 3 3 会报错,因为必须要输入-f

image.png


gmx genconf -f md.gro -trj md.xtc -o 8.gro -nbox 3 3 3 

image.png

image.png

不像原来的重复,就是从轨迹总进行读取放入进来,根据数量来判断,5 5 5明显比3 3 3多

image.png

image.png

会出现1nm的间隔


image.png

再次导入轨迹就没有效果了


最新评论
请先登录才能进行回复登录
技术支持: CLOUD | 管理登录
seo seo